Purpose-built solution reduces data pipeline complexity and accelerates integration across hybrid and multi-cloud Databricks environments
CHAPEL HILL, N.C., June 11,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— CData Software, a leading provider of data connectivity and integration solutions, today announced the launch of the CData Databricks Integration Accelerator, a new solution purpose-built to simplify and expedite enterprise data integration for Databricks environments. By eliminating traditional bottlenecks in data pipeline development, the Accelerator can reduce integration timelines by as much as 90%, helping organizations unlock insights faster and fully realize the potential of their Databricks Lakehouse investments.
The Databricks Lakehouse Platform combines data warehousing and AI with a unified architecture that supports real-time analytics and machine learning workflows. Yet, many enterprises encounter friction when integrating data from disparate systems due to the fragmented nature of legacy ETL tools and the need to support hybrid environments, including on-premises infrastructure and multi-cloud deployments. The CData Databricks Integration Accelerator mitigates these challenges by offering a no-code framework for building scalable ingestion pipelines, simplifying transformation tasks, and ensuring compliance with data governance standards like Unity Catalog.

Overview of Databricks Solution Toolkits
The CData Databricks Integration Accelerator includes four purpose-built toolkits designed to enhance data integration capabilities:
- Delta Lake Integration Toolkit: Enable no-code data ingestion into Delta Lake with Change Data Capture (CDC) from over 270 sources. This toolkit also facilitates live data access into sales, marketing, financial, and other business systems via Databricks Lakehouse Federation, ensuring full governance through Unity Catalog.
- Delta Live Tables (DLT) Extension Toolkit: Expand DLT connectivity to all business applications, providing a unified SQL data model via Databricks Spark for simplified integration. The toolkit includes out-of-the-box authentication and pagination support for any API, along with server-side pushdown for optimal performance.
- Databricks-Microsoft Connectivity Toolkit: Leverage standards-based connectivity between Databricks and Microsoft ecosystems, enabling native integration capabilities with SSAS, SSRS, SSIS, and more. The toolkit ensures performant live connectivity into Databricks from any application while maintaining complete Unity Catalog compatibility.
- Agentic Data Pipelines Toolkit: Supercharge agentic workloads with CData’s automated data ingestion capabilities, enabling true programmatic ingest into serverless PostgreSQL, fully compatible with Databricks serverless Postgres deployments. The toolkit provides instant data availability for AI agents with automated pipelines from any enterprise data source into Databricks serverless Postgres, programmatic orchestration to build and modify data pipelines via code, and real-time processing to integrate data from any source on-the-fly with CDC.

Customer Success: NJM Insurance
NJM Insurance, a leading provider of personal and commercial insurance, leveraged the CData Databricks Integration Accelerator to transform their marketing analytics. By replacing code-intensive ETL processes with CData’s no-code solution, NJM reduced integration build time by 90% and saved 66% on project costs. This enabled faster insights into customer acquisition costs and lifetime value, driving better decision-making across the organization. “With CData, we were able to ingest our marketing data into Databricks 10 times faster, allowing us to make data-driven decisions more quickly,” said Ameya Narvekar, Data Insights Supervisor at NJM Insurance.
